Baylor Scott & White Health, the organization formed from the 2013 merger between Baylor Health Care System and Scott & White Healthcare, is today the largest not-for-profit health care system in the state of Texas. Serving a population larger than the state of Georgia, Baylor Scott & White Health has the vision and resources to provide its patients continued quality care while creating a model system for a dramatically changing health care environment. Signal Genetics is a commercial stage, molecular diagnostic company focused on providing innovative diagnostic services that help physicians make better-informed decisions concerning the care of their patients suffering from cancer. The company was founded in April 2010 after becoming the exclusive licensee to the world-renowned research on multiple myeloma (MM) performed at the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ences (UAMS). Signal Genetics’ flagship product - MyPRS (Myeloma Prognostic Risk Signature) is based upon more than two decades of clinical research on nearly 10,000 MM patients who received their care at UAMS. Signal Genetics offer the MyPRS test out of its state-of-the-art, CLIA certified reference laboratory located in Little Rock, AR. The company is dedicated to making its extensively validated diagnostic services available to all patients who need them.
